[摘 要]本文針對(duì)陶瓷瓷磚色差分析、分類檢測(cè)中出現(xiàn)的問(wèn)題,提出對(duì)瓷磚圖像處理時(shí)要先進(jìn)行圖像預(yù)處理,闡述了預(yù)處理的步驟和相應(yīng)的算法。
[關(guān)鍵詞]中值濾波 邊界提取 邊緣檢測(cè)
陶瓷瓷磚生產(chǎn)中由于瓷土配料、生產(chǎn)工藝、流程的波動(dòng)等原因,同一批次不同瓷磚之間或者不同批次的瓷磚之間不可避免地出現(xiàn)色彩與圖案等方面的差異。瓷磚圖像處理的第一步就是圖像預(yù)處理,即對(duì)圖像質(zhì)量進(jìn)行改善。圖像的預(yù)處理主要包括中值濾波(噪聲處理)和瓷磚邊界的提取。
一、中值濾波
在一般的噪聲處理中,我們經(jīng)常提到中值濾波這個(gè)概念,它是采用次數(shù)比較多的低通濾波器,主要是對(duì)噪聲的處理和對(duì)原始圖像的最大保護(hù)。中值濾波容易去除孤立點(diǎn)、線噪聲,同時(shí)保持圖像邊緣。在用中值濾波處理實(shí)際的圖像時(shí),有兩點(diǎn)操作需要注意:一是要保證選用的模板沒(méi)有被超出邊界,盡量讓處理前后的圖像差別不要太大,所以在操作中不處理邊界元素,只復(fù)制圖像中的灰度值到處理后的圖像中;二是碰到要處理的圖像太大時(shí),需要對(duì)常用的模版進(jìn)行重新選擇。
用中值濾波處理圖像的步驟如下:
(1)將模板在圖像中漫游,并將模板中心與圖中某個(gè)像素位置重合;
(2)讀取模板下每個(gè)對(duì)應(yīng)像素的灰度值;
(3)將這些灰度值從小到大排成一列;
(4)找出這些值里排在中間的一個(gè);
(5)將這個(gè)中間值賦給對(duì)應(yīng)模板中心位置的像素。
二、瓷磚邊界的提取
瓷磚圖像具有以下特點(diǎn):一是瓷磚與背景之間有較好的對(duì)比度;二是圖像的背景均勻且不含直線,以便清楚地獲取瓷磚的邊界,有助于尋找瓷磚對(duì)于某個(gè)參考方向的近似旋轉(zhuǎn)角度。瓷磚色差檢測(cè)分類的關(guān)鍵是檢測(cè)的范圍應(yīng)該是有效范圍,能夠反映真實(shí)的色差值。因此就需要提取出瓷磚圖像的有效部分來(lái)進(jìn)行檢測(cè)。
具體實(shí)現(xiàn)步驟是:
(1)利用局部峰值搜索方法找出四條邊界;
(2)根據(jù)所得到的四條邊界判斷是否需要進(jìn)行旋轉(zhuǎn),如需要旋轉(zhuǎn)進(jìn)入下一步,否則進(jìn)入步驟(4);
(3)根據(jù)邊界組成矩形的四個(gè)頂點(diǎn)計(jì)算出所需旋轉(zhuǎn)的角度,選取矩形的中心作為參考點(diǎn)進(jìn)行相應(yīng)的旋轉(zhuǎn);
(4)求得此時(shí)矩形的四個(gè)頂點(diǎn)坐標(biāo),以便有效范圍圖像的色差計(jì)算。
三、圖像的邊緣檢測(cè)
在對(duì)瓷磚圖像邊界的提取后就需要對(duì)圖像的邊緣進(jìn)行檢測(cè),最基本的處理方法就是圖像的邊緣檢測(cè),它也是對(duì)圖像進(jìn)行基于邊界的分割處理時(shí)采用的第一步。由于我們的眼睛在對(duì)場(chǎng)景中亮度變化較快的地方和不同物體相交互的地方總是比較敏感,大多都認(rèn)為圖像的邊緣部分包含了圖像的大部分信息,所以在對(duì)圖像邊緣的確定與提取是有現(xiàn)實(shí)意義的。
常用的邊緣檢測(cè)方法有:基于一階導(dǎo)數(shù)的梯度算子方法的羅伯特交叉(Roberts cross)算子、普瑞威特(Prewitt)邊緣算子及索貝爾(Sobel)邊緣算子和基于二階導(dǎo)數(shù)算子的拉普拉斯算子及高斯-拉普拉斯算子。
。
參考文獻(xiàn):
[1]章毓晉.圖像處理和分析.清華大學(xué)出版社,2000
[2]章毓晉.圖像理解與計(jì)算機(jī)視覺(jué).清華大學(xué)出版社, 2000
[3]GB/T11941-89.彩色釉面陶瓷墻地磚.中華人民共和國(guó)國(guó)家標(biāo)準(zhǔn),1989